Bonniers Konsthall, in collaboration with Lenz Press, is proud to present Lawrence Abu Hamdan’s first major monograph, Dirty Evidence. This richly illustrated publication delivers a comprehensive overview of the artist’s practice over the last 10+ years. The book presents an in-depth visual analysis of Abu Hamdan’s work accompanied by commissioned essays that focus on single pieces as well as on the artist’s oeuvre. Scholarly and creative reflections explore the political aspects of key work by Abu Hamdan, while a complete list of works to date makes this monograph a crucial tool for curators and researchers working in and around the subjects…
Authors: Lawrence Abu Hamdan, Natasha Ginwala, Ruba Katrib, Andrea Lissoni, Ramona Naddaff, Theodor Ringborg, Fabian Schöneich, Yasmine Seale and Eyal Weizman.
